  2. "causal connection ": no no and no ! A statistical CORRELATION has NEVER BEEN EQUIVALENT to A CAUSAL RELATION ! Every statistician knows it but the public is prompt to confound the two. So there must be two steps in proving a causal connection:
    1°) a statistical correlation (which must be statistically significant of course and not only casual facts)
    2°) a CAUSAL connection

    The correlation between the nile or stock market and moon or planets could be made rather easily since it copes with numbers whereas correlation between astrology and personalities would be more difficult to prove. But as I just said above the first step doesn't prove the SECOND STEP. And that's the problem today the mystics hide the second step or are not even aware of something missing rigourously.
